Norcross, GA asian restaurants & food

Lal Qilla

Restaurant

4771 Britt Rd, Norcross, GA 30093
(770) 939-5003
Excellent Good Average Poor Awful 5.0 / 5 based on 1 vote

We don't know much about this place. It is probably new or not well known.
You can try your luck and visit this restaurant or take a look at the restaurants nearby.

Nearby Restaurants

  • Vien Huong
    Vien Huong Vietnamese Restaurant 4771 Britt Rd Ste F1 Norcross, GA 30093
  • I Luv Pho
    I Luv Pho Vietnamese Restaurant 4650 Jimmy Carter Blvd Ste 133-B Norcross, GA 30093
  • Lazeez Tava Fry
    Lazeez Tava Fry Indian Restaurant 4650 Jimmy Carter Blvd Ste 133-A Norcross, GA 30093
  • Taj Mahal
    Taj Mahal Indian Restaurant 4650 Jimmy Carter Blvd Norcross, GA 30093
  • Kohinoor Indian Restaurant
    Kohinoor Indian Restaurant 1158 Rockbridge Rd Norcross, GA 30093
  • Pho Vu
    Pho Vu 1201 Rockbridge Road, #L Norcross, GA 30093